What is the liability minor form?
The liability minor form, also known as the liability child form, is a legal document designed to protect organizations and individuals from claims arising from activities involving minors. This form outlines the responsibilities of the parent or guardian and the potential risks associated with the activity. It is often used in contexts such as sports, camps, and other recreational activities where minors participate. By signing this document, the parent or guardian acknowledges the risks and agrees to release the organization from liability in case of accidents or injuries.
Key elements of the liability minor form
A well-crafted liability minor form typically includes several essential elements to ensure its effectiveness and legal standing. These elements may consist of:
- Identification of parties: Clearly state the names of the minor, parent or guardian, and the organization involved.
- Description of activities: Provide a detailed account of the activities the minor will participate in, including any inherent risks.
- Assumption of risk: A section where the parent or guardian acknowledges understanding the risks involved.
- Release of liability: A clause that releases the organization from liability for injuries or damages incurred during the activities.
- Signature and date: A space for the parent or guardian to sign and date the form, indicating consent.

Legal use of the liability minor form
The legal use of the liability minor form hinges on its compliance with state laws and regulations. For the form to be enforceable, it must meet specific criteria, including clarity in language and the explicit acknowledgment of risks by the parent or guardian. Additionally, the form should not contain any clauses that contravene public policy or state laws. It is advisable for organizations to consult legal counsel to ensure that the form adheres to applicable legal standards.

Examples of using the liability minor form
The liability minor form is commonly utilized in various scenarios to mitigate risk. Examples include:
- Sports leagues: Youth sports organizations often require parents to sign this form before allowing minors to participate in games and practices.
- Summer camps: Camps typically use the form to inform parents of potential risks associated with activities like swimming, hiking, or climbing.
- Recreational classes: Organizations offering classes in arts, crafts, or adventure sports may require the form to protect against liability.
